
'Tis the season to eat, drink and be merry, but festivities extend onto the road and can be deadly. In December of 2008 there were 7,104 motor vehicle fatalities in the United States with 520 of them related to drunk driving. Drunk driving is a majory safety issue and is more prevalent during the festive holiday season.
